Does Interlimb Knee Symmetry Exist After Unicompartmental Knee Arthroplasty?
BACKGROUND: Unicompartmental knee arthroplasty (UKA) has long been a treatment option for patients with disease limited primarily to one compartment with small, correctable deformities.
